Pyrrha Wanderlust BN1001 Bronze

The scallop featured on this talisman signifies travel to unknown places, and the wolf represents a courageous spirit. The three dice remind us to take chances in life.

As a certified carbon-neutral B Corp, they are committed to environmental responsibility — their jewelry is sustainably handcrafted with 100% recycled metals in their Vancouver studio using antique wax seals and imagery from the Victorian era. Member of 1% for the Planet, Ethical Metalsmiths, and the Responsible Jewellery Council.

Handcrafted in Vancouver, Canada
Cast in 100% recycled sterling silver or bronze
Sterling silver chain and lobster clasp with Pyrrha branded quality tag
Letterpress printed meaning card (handmade from recycled materials)
